NABS ENDOWMENT STUDENT TRAVEL AWARDS

The NABS Endowment committee will award a total of eight (8) student travel awards of $300 each for the NABS 2000 Annual Meeting at Keystone Resort, Colorado. Awards will be from the General Endowment fund (4 awards, all topics), Simpson Fund (1 award, applied topics), Americas Fund (1 award, student must be from Latin America), Peterson Fund (1 award, student must be non-North American), and the Boesel-Sanderson Fund (1 award, natural history topics).

Applicants for the awards must be graduate students in good standing and must have submitted an abstract for the 2000 meeting. Copies of the abstract should also be submitted to the Endowment committee by January 7, 2000, accompanied by a letter from the applicant indicating the desire for travel support. The travel awards are based on the quality of the research and the abstract; the need for support is a secondary consideration. Winning students will be informed by mid-February, and will be recognized in the Spring Program Bulletin. They will also be introduced at the NABS2000 Business Luncheon.

Five (5) copies of the abstract submitted for presentation at the 2000 Keystone meeting and a letter indicating the need for travel support should be submitted in time to be received by January 7, 2000, to:
